“I Am,” a new cantata with text by Richard Leach and music by Bob Moore, was recently premiered at The Episcopal Church of Our Saviour in Jacksonville, Fl. The six movements are based upon the “I am” statements of Christ in the Gospel of John For inquiries regarding this work, please contact Bob Moore via […]

“Hymn of the Redeemed” by John Foulds arranged for SSAATTBB
John Foulds has been called one of the most unjustly neglected musical geniuses of the 20th century and was almost completely forgotten for almost a half-century after his death in 1939. However, his World Requiem, a massive large-scale work for vocal soloists, multiple choirs, and a large orchestra written as a memorial to the dead […]

Chicago Children’s Choir – South African Workshops
Learn more authentic approaches to singing and teaching traditional black South African choral music. Chicago Children’s Choir continues its Future Music Educators Initiative with a four-day South African Workshop from August 20-23, 2019. This study of Black South African choral music will be led by renowned singer, music director, composer and theatrical producer Bongani Magatyana. […]
